Analysis
In 2023, cocoa beans — gross production value in Nicaragua stood at 13,710 1000 Int$.
The figure is down 3.4% on the previous year and up 132.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, cocoa beans — gross production value in Nicaragua peaked at 14,188 1000 Int$ in 2022 and was at its lowest, 294 1000 Int$, in 1987.
Nicaragua ranks 22nd of 54 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
